Title: GEA provides dryers for lithium processing

GEA processes are utilized in lithium processes. The evaporation, crystallization and fluid bed drying technologies can be tailored to produce one or more of the lithium salts as well as their by-products, including sodium or Glauber’s salts, and lithium chloride for alloy applications. GEA fluid bed dryers are ideally suited to multi-zone operation with drying and cooling taking place in the same unit. The equipment can be designed for high temperatures and is available in an all metal, washable design. Contact tubes or plates can be incorporated with non-cohesive materials. The result is a significant reduction in airflow compared with the typical standard fluid bed, providing a higher thermal efficiency as well as lower electrical consumption with a reduced footprint. GEA is delivering key process equipment, including packaging, for production of a pure lithium hydroxide monohydrate (LiOH.H2O), with dried sodium sulphate as a by-product, to a major Chinese/Australian lithium company.
